Theory of plastic flows of CDWs in application to a current conversion

S. Brazovski1, 2 and N. Kirova1

1  Laboratoire de Physique Théorique et des Modèles Statistiques, CNRS, bâtiment 100, Université Paris-Sud, 91406 Orsay cedex, France
2  L.D. Landau Institute, Moscow, Russia


Abstract
We suggest a theoretical picture for distributions of plastic deformations experienced by a sliding Charge Density Wave in the course of the conversion from the normal current at the contact to the collective one in the bulk. Several mechanisms of phase slips via creation and proliferation of dislocations are compared. The results are applied to space resolved X-ray [1,2], multi-contact [3,4] and optical [5] studies. Numerical simulations are combined with model independent relations.
